Understanding Predictive Modeling
Predictive modeling is a branch of data analytics that uses statistical algorithms and machine learning techniques to identify the likelihood of future outcomes based on historical data. By analyzing patterns in data, predictive models can forecast customer behavior, sales trends, and operational efficiencies.
The Role of AI in Predictive Modeling
AI enhances predictive modeling capabilities through algorithms that can analyze vast datasets far beyond human capacity. These advanced systems can automatically learn from data and improve their predictive abilities over time. Key AI technologies used in predictive modeling include:
- Machine Learning: Algorithms that adjust and improve predictions based on new data.
- Natural Language Processing: Enables systems to understand and interpret human language in sales communication.
- Neural Networks: Mimic the human brains operations, allowing for more complex and accurate predictions.
Applications of Predictive Modeling in Sales
Predictive modeling provides actionable insights across various sales-related areas, including:
- Lead Scoring: Businesses can prioritize leads by predicting which prospects are most likely to convert, significantly improving conversion rates.
- Customer Segmentation: AI algorithms analyze purchasing behavior to create customer segments, allowing for more targeted marketing efforts.
- Sales Forecasting: Accurate projections enable businesses to allocate resources more effectively and set realistic sales targets.
Case Studies Demonstrating Success
Several companies have successfully implemented predictive modeling to enhance their sales performance:
- Amazon: Through its recommendation engine, Amazon utilizes predictive modeling to analyze customer behavior and suggest products, leading to increased sales and customer loyalty.
- Salesforce: With its Einstein AI platform, Salesforce uses predictive analytics to empower sales teams to make data-driven decisions by analyzing current leads and past performance.

Addressing Potential Concerns
While the benefits of predictive modeling are substantial, organizations may face challenges, such as:
- Data Quality: Inaccurate or incomplete data can lead to flawed predictions.
- Integration: Seamlessly integrating predictive models into existing systems can be complex.
Organizations can mitigate these issues by investing in data cleaning processes and ensuring cross-departmental collaboration during implementation.
